Goldie Tidwell Platé, 88, of Columbia, passed away peacefully into Heaven on September 22, 2020 with her family by her side. Born March 7, 1932, in Columbia, she was a daughter of the late Dalton C. Tidwell and Ollie Easler Sharpe.
A devoted wife and mother, Goldie was known for her boundless energy and eternal optimism. She always provided much love and laughter to her family and friends. Goldie left an indelible impression on everyone she met. She was a one-of-a-kind spirit who will be greatly missed.
Mrs. Platé is survived by her only son, Kevin Platé and his wife, Renée, and grandson, Trenton Platé, all of North Tustin, California. Additional surviving family includes three sisters, June Cornell, Cathy Hearn, and Margie Prather.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band of 55 years, Charles Platé, sister, Barbara Condon, and her brother, Dalton Tidwell, Jr.
